How to get to and around Beeston

Fly into Nottingham (NQT), the closest airport, located 5.5 mi (8.8 km) from the city centre. If you can't find a flight that works for your travel itinerary, you might consider flying into East Midlands Airport (EMA), which is 8.3 mi (13.4 km) away.

If you're travelling by train, the main station is Beeston Station.
